What: #19 FAU (21-2, 11-1) vs. Charlotte (13-9, 4-7)
When: Sat. Feb 4th, @ 4:00 PM
Where: Halton Arena
Series: FAU holds a 7-6 edge over the 49ers
TV: ESPN+
Radio: FoxSports 640
Live Stats: Here
Line: FAU -3.5
Owl Notables
UAB’s Jelly Walker returned from a five-game absence and posted 13 points and six assists to help the Blazers snap Florida Atlantic’s 20-game winning streak 86-77 on Thursday night.
A key factor was the Owls' 22% showing from downtown. In the 3-point battle, FAU is 11-0 when shooting a higher percentage than its opponents and 18-1 when making more threes than its opponents
Guard Michael Forrest is one three pointer from tying the program record of 287 (Greg Gantt 2009-13) after the UAB contest as he is now fourth place all-time in scoring with 1,503 points.
Record Updates
- Season wins 21 (record 22)
- Home win streak of 14 games (record 15)
49er Notables
Despite a 27-point scoring outburst by junior Brice Williams, Charlotte fell at home, 57-54, to a red hot FIU squad that walked away with its fourth consecutive victory.
Williams scored his 27 points on 8-of-15 shooting, while draining a career-high four 3-pointers and knocking down all seven of his attempts from the charity stripe to help give CLT the lead in the final minute.
A win over the 19th-ranked Owls would be Charlotte's first home victory over a top-25 opponent, since CLT took down No. 15 Temple , 74-64 on Jan. 27, 2010 in A-10 action.
